Patients Health Monitoring Using Iot Pdf Internet Of Things Arduino In this project to analyze and compute the patient health we are using arduino, which is the heart of this project. arduino controls the output devices like buzzer, relay and gsm modem. This document describes a student project to develop a low cost patient health monitoring system using iot. the system aims to monitor multiple health parameters (temperature, blood pressure, pulse oximetry, heartbeat, room temperature and humidity) using a single device.
